![]() remove loose or cracked area as similar to be seen in attached picture.similar to the above, please protect for potential mess and dust.Installation of sheetrock and finishing now can be performed as it is in every other sheetrock project.Due to the age of your home shimming of studs, adding studs or nailers might be required as home building was quite different and standards varied by builder.Prior to installing new wallboard in an older home you might want to contact an electrician to add or adjust electrical outlets and switches.You will also find the plaster debris is quite heavy. when removing all debris use rubber barrels as the plaster edges can be sharp and will puncture plastic bags.There will be numerous small tack nails that is left behind from removing the laths, this will need to be removed remove the plaster and laths from the wall.a hammer is sometimes required to assist in braking the bond with the plaster and laths as the plaster in some cases is still adhered to the wall with the curls that formed when the plaster dried.protect all areas with heavy plastic and or drop cloths.Please note: any time you disrupt plaster on the wall for either replacing or repairing a large section this procedure will be quite messy and dusty so always were a dust respirator and protect all surfaces for the debris and dust. Plaster and lath means you have plaster walls. These are called curls.Ä«etween approximately 19 Horse Hair was added to the plaster as a reinforcement to the plaster. The dried plaster on the back side of the finished walls curls around the laths as it dries. A plaster mixture is then mixed and spread over the laths which are spaced with approximately a half-inch in between each which allows the plaster mixture to push thru (ooze) and dry which locks the dried plaster in place. Plaster walls crack and hanging art on them can be a challenge. Plaster and lath is a combination of spaced wood laths nailed to the framework of the home.
